Uses
Helps protect skin and supports healing of minor cuts, scrapes, burns and wounds, includ-ing pressure sores, diabetic ulcers, cracked skin and lips. Topical antiseptic to help decrease the risk of skin infections.

Directions:
Wound cleansing for adults and children 2 years of age and older:
Spray the affected area to clean dirt and debris, use a small amount of the product and wipe it off with a sterile gauze.
For use as First Aid antiseptic for adults and children 2 years of age and older:
- Clean the affected area
- Spray a small amount of this product on the area 1 to 3 times daily or as needed
- Wipe off excess with sterile gauze
- Cover affected area with a sterile bandage if needed
- When bandaged, let dry first
For children under 2 years of age: please, consult a doctor
